I feel like Pitchfork has fully evolved into the kind of establishment it once mocked.  What started as an outsider voice challenging old music media now feels like a gatekeeping platform, where critics act culturally superior and decide what music is “worthy” of attention.

Pop music is especially dismissed unless it can be framed as ironic, intellectual, or whatever.  Putting reviews behind a paywall is the final nail in the coffin. Reviews were Pitchfork’s core contribution and the reason people showed up in the first place. Locking them away doesn’t elevate criticism. It just confirms the elitism. :laughga:
